Frequently Asked Questions

How do I start an integration between Beamer and Airtable?

To start, connect both your Beamer and Airtable accounts to viaSocket. Once connected, you can set up a workflow where an event in Beamer triggers actions in Airtable (or vice versa).

Can we customize how data from Beamer is recorded in Airtable?

Absolutely. You can customize how Beamer data is recorded in Airtable. This includes choosing which data fields go into which fields of Airtable, setting up custom formats, and filtering out unwanted information.

How often does the data sync between Beamer and Airtable?

The data sync between Beamer and Airtable typically happens in real-time through instant triggers. And a maximum of 15 minutes in case of a scheduled trigger.

Can I filter or transform data before sending it from Beamer to Airtable?

Yes, viaSocket allows you to add custom logic or use built-in filters to modify data according to your needs.

Is it possible to add conditions to the integration between Beamer and Airtable?

Yes, you can set conditional logic to control the flow of data between Beamer and Airtable. For instance, you can specify that data should only be sent if certain conditions are met, or you can create if/else statements to manage different outcomes.

About Beamer

Beamer is an easy to use newsfeed and changelog for your website or app. Use it to announce news and features, and improve user engagement.

About Airtable

Airtable is a cloud-based platform for creating and sharing relational databases. The user-friendly interface allows anyone to spin up a database in minutes.
